Transaction 76ce88c18ac8d9c17d38df06c73a7d7d0cabd9c857ab9f40d6a5ec3850a67d62
1 Input
1 Output
-
76ce88c18ac8d9c17d38df06c73a7d7d0cabd9c857ab9f40d6a5ec3850a67d62:0
- value
- 500007
- script pubkey
- OP_0 OP_PUSHBYTES_20 ec937b627135c8e3b829d62bad13bfda119c83ee
- address
- bc1qajfhkcn3xhyw8wpf6c466yalmggeeqlw4m7ehz